Reggie Thinks Decision To Sell Nintendo Switch 2 Welcome Tour May Be Incorrect

Former Nintendo of America president Reggie Fils-Aime has shared his thoughts on Nintendo Switch 2 Welcome Tour, which many fans have thought should have been a pack-in title, instead of a separate digital purchase for USD9.99.

For those who are unaware, Reggie pushed for Wii Sports to be a pack-in with the Wii as a universal experience for consumrs, something which Mario creator Shigeru Miyamoto was strongly against and unhappy about as he thought software shouldn’t be given away for free to respect the hard work created by developers.

They ended up compromising by packing in Wii Sports in the west, and not including it in as a pack-in in Japan.

So, what does Reggie think of Nintendo Switch 2 Welcome Tour? In an interview with NVC, Reggie said that he feels the decision to sell Nintendo Switch 2 Welcome Tour as a separate product may be “incorrect”.
